Ghost VM trying to be backed up

Networker 8.2.1.4 on Windows Server 2012r2

VBA 1.1.1.50

Hello all,

A few weeks ago, our VM engineer cloned a VM. Let's say the name is "vmserver2016". The clone name was "vmserver2016-clone". Once they finished with the clone, he removed it. Nothing unusual here.

However, for the past three weeks, Networker has tried to back up a VM named "vmserver2016-clone". It does successfully back up the original one named "vmserver2016", but also tries to back up that clone, as though Networker is having a hard time forgetting about this clone VM, or somehow still sees it. That name "vmserver2016-clone" exists nowhere in our VM environment that we can find. The backup job log simply shows "STATUS=UNKNOWN".

The scenario I have described above has happened to us several times in the past as well, after VM's have been decommissioned and removed. This usually stops happening a few days to a week after the VM is gone, but there was one time before where they simply would no go away. I reached out to EMC, and they sent me some commands to clear some sort of cache (which made sense to me), but those commands completely wiped out all of my VM selections in our VSphere client, so I wont try that again. 

FYI, I'm using DPS Suite, which is essentially Networker with Avamar built in, so Im still a bit confused about whether VM backup issues should be assigned to the Networker discussions, or in Avamar.
